Just an intersting thing that I've mentioned before regarding gun safes, and many manufacturers have safes that will fail this test.
To do this test, open your safe door about half way. Assuming you're right handed, raise your right knee and place it about half way up the door near the opening edge. With your right hand, grab the top corner at the opening edge. Push with your knee, and pull with your hand, and see what the door does. Put as much effort into it as you can, as you won't hurt the safe.
What you may see if you look closely is the door flexing back and forth. Some will be a lot more obvious than others.
The moral of the story: If you can bend the door by hand, it is probably not as burglary resistant as the manufacturer led you to believe.
